PSEC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2020 in Review

206 of the 4,538 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Prospect Capital (PSEC) for Q1 2020, worth a combined $177M — down 49% from $350M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 38 funds closed out of PSEC and 29 opened new positions — a net loss of 9 holders — while 78 trimmed existing stakes and 59 added.

The largest buyer was Sumitomo Mitsui Trust Group, opening a new position worth an estimated $14.5M. The largest seller was Arrowstreet Capital, cutting an estimated $20.5M.
